AC coupled solar systems are designed to separate the solar generation and energy storage systems. In these setups, solar panels generate electricity in direct current (DC), which is then converted to alternating current (AC) for use in the home or commercial facility. This unique arrangement allows for flexibility in system design and integration with existing energy assets.

One of the primary benefits of AC coupled systems is their scalability. Users can start with a smaller solar array and add more panels or batteries over time as their energy needs grow or as their budgets allow. This makes it an attractive option for those who may want to dip their toes into solar energy without committing to a large upfront investment.

Another key advantage is the ability to integrate various energy sources seamlessly. With an AC coupled system, it is easy to combine solar energy with other forms of power generation, such as wind or generator systems. This versatility can lead to a more reliable and consistent energy supply, allowing users to benefit from multiple renewable energy streams.

In addition, AC coupling simplifies the integration of energy storage systems. With battery storage becoming an increasingly vital part of the energy landscape, AC coupled systems enable easier connection to batteries, allowing for effective load management and increasing the efficiency of energy use. This ensures that excess energy produced during the day can be stored and utilized during peak hours or at night, thus optimizing energy consumption.

Despite these advantages, there are best practices to consider when implementing an AC coupled solar system. First, it is vital to choose high-quality components that are compatible with one another. This ensures optimal performance and longevity of the system. For instance, selecting appropriate inverters that can handle the specific requirements of both the solar array and storage system is crucial.

Regular maintenance is also essential for keeping systems running efficiently. Scheduling routine checks and servicing can help identify potential issues before they escalate, minimizing downtime and maximizing energy yield. Users should maintain clear records of system performance, as this data can help diagnose problems or inefficiencies.

Furthermore, proper system design is critical. Customizing a solar array to meet specific energy needs and site conditions ensures that the system operates efficiently. Factors such as shading, roof orientation, and tilt angle can significantly impact energy generation and should be carefully considered during the installation phase.

In addition, educating users on energy efficiency measures can amplify the benefits of an AC coupled solar system. Simple changes like using energy-efficient appliances or optimizing usage times can further reduce energy costs and reliance on grid electricity. Coupling these strategies with a solar system maximizes savings and enhances overall sustainability.
